- New internal/fs package for testable filesystem operations - In-memory filesystem support for unit testing without disk I/O - Swappable global FS: SetFS(afero.NewMemMapFs()) - Wrapper functions: ReadFile, WriteFile, Mkdir, Walk, Glob, etc. - Testing helpers: WithMemFs(), SetupTestDir() - Comprehensive test suite demonstrating usage - Upgraded afero from v1.10.0 to v1.15.0
